The paper considers two weakly singular Fredholm boundary integral equations of the first kind to each of which the three-dimensional Helmholtz transmission problem can be reduced. The properties of these equations are studied on the spectra, where they are ill posed. For the first equation, it is shown that its solution, if it exists on the spectrum, allows finding a solution of the transmission problem. The second equation in this case always has infinitely many solutions, with only one of them giving a solution of the transmission problem. The interpolation method for finding approximate solutions of the integral equations and the transmission problem in question is discussed.
A direct method (self-regularization method) for the numerical solution of a weakly singular integral equation of the first kind on a closed surface is considered. This equation is an integral formulation of the internal and external three-dimensional Dirichlet problems for the Laplace equation if their solutions are sought in the form of a single-layer potential. It is approximated by a system of linear algebraic equations, which is solved numerically. In this case, a new method of averaging the kernel of the integral operator is used. It preserves the conditional correctness of the discretized problem and significantly increases the rate of convergence of its solution to the exact solution of the integral equation.

The pipe wall thickness was estimated based on three-dimensional images of the pipe recovered from several X-ray projections, which were made in a limited angle of view. Since the effects of scattered radiation and beam hardening are up to 50 % of the main radiation, ignoring them leads to blur of the image and inaccuracy in determining dimensions. To restore pipe images from projections, a volume and/or shell representation of the pipe is used, as well as iterative Bayesian methods. Using these methods, the error in estimating the pipe wall thickness from the projection data can be equal to or less than 300 μm. It has been shown that standard X-ray projections on the film or imaging plates used to obtain data can be used to restore pipe wall thickness profiles in factory conditions.

Purpose. Improving the technology of machine learning, deep learning and artificial intelligence plays an important role in acquiring new knowledge, technological modernization and the digital economy development.An important factor of the development in these areas is the availability of an appropriate highperformance computing infrastructure capable of providing the processing of large amounts of data. The creation of coprocessorbased hybrid computing systems, as well as new parallel programming technologies and application development tools allows partial solving this problem. However, many issues of organizing the effective multiuser operation of this class of systems require a separate study. The current paper addresses research in this area. Methodology. Using the OpenPOWER architecturebased cluster in the Shared Services Center The Data Center of the Far Eastern Branch of the Russian Academy of Sciences, the features of the functioning of hybrid computing systems are considered and solutions are proposed for organizing their work in a multiuser mode. Based on the virtual nodes concept, an adaptation of the PBS Professional job scheduling system was carried out, which provides an efficient allocation of cluster hardware resources among user tasks. Application virtualization technology was used for effective execution of machine learning and deep learning problems. Findings. The implemented cluster software environment with the integrated task scheduling system is designed to work with a wide range of computer applications, including programs built using parallel programming technologies. The virtualization technologies were used in this environment for effective execution of the software, based on machine learning, deep learning and artificial intelligence. Having the capabilities of the container Singularity, a specialized software stack and its operation mode was implemented for execution machine learning, deep learning and artificial intelligence tasks on a unified computing digital platform. Originality. The features of hybrid computing platforms functioning are considered, and the approach for their effective multiuser work mode is proposed. An effective resource manage model is developed, based on the virtualization technology usage.

Currently, one of the most important tasks is the development and adaptation of iterative methods for solving ultra-large sparse systems of algebraic equations. Such computational problems are caused by the iterative parallel reconstruction of three-dimensional images of industrial products. It is important that iterative methods for solving computational problems of large size are implemented on parallel structures much more efficiently than direct methods for solving them. This paper describes a synchronous parallel algorithm based on the MPI system for solving the problem of reconstruction of three-dimensional images of industrial products. Methodology. It is important that iterative methods for solving computational problems of larger dimensionality on parallel structures are implemented more efficiently than the direct ones. Most algorithms based on direct solving methods have a significant hereditary sequential structure and require a large number of processors interactions which cannot be executed in parallel mode. Iterative methods, for the most part, require a significantly smaller number of interactions of this type and are relatively easily mapped onto parallel computational structures. Equally important, in most cases parallel implementations of classical iterative methods are more effective in terms of computational speed. The parallel execution of the algorithm is based on the distribution of the process in some way between various groups of processors. Depending on the interaction method between local processors, two different types of parallel iterative algorithms execution are distinguished: synchronous and asynchronous. In the former case, it is assumed that the processors complete the calculations and exchange all the necessary results before the start of a new iteration. The main disadvantage of synchronous parallel algorithms is that they require synchronization of iterations. This is a very difficult task, especially with large number of processors. In addition, the overall calculation speed is limited by the speed of the slowest processor. At the same time, faster processors spend most of their time in the waiting mode. But, nevertheless, the implementation of these parallel algorithms can be effectively achieved using the MPI standard. Findings. Synchronous parallel computing algorithms and program codes for threedimensional tomographic reconstruction in a conical beam were developed. Program code debugging and numerical calculations were performed on a hybrid cluster based on the OpenPOWER architecture using the MPI system. For designing a parallel threedimensional tomographic reconstruction, a voxel form of parallelism was used. Originality. Implemented parallel iterative technology of three-dimensional images reconstruction has undeniable advantages over traditional sequential iterative tomographic reconstruction. It allows reducing the time of tomographic reconstruction as many as tens of times, provides the ability to reconstruct products with sizes of 5123 to 10243 voxels with simultaneous storage of the submatrix node of the projection matrix in RAM, which eliminates the need for recalculation of matrix coefficients for each new iteration.
The three-dimensional diffraction problem of stationary acoustic waves on a homogeneous inclusion is considered. It is reduced to the weakly singular boundary Fredholm integral equations of the first kind with one unknown function, each of which is conditionally equivalent to the original problem. By using the original method of averaging the integral operators kernels, these equations are approximated by systems of linear algebraic equations. The resulting systems are solved numerically by the generalized minimal residual method (GMRES). Then the solution of the initial problem is calculated. To find the solution on the spectrum of integral operators, where the condition of equivalence of integral equations to the original problem is violated, the interpolation solution method is proposed. It does not require knowledge of the spectrum and allows us to find the approximated solutions with high accuracy. The proposed algorithms have been implemented in the computing cluster of Computing Center FEB RAS. The results of the calculations that allow us to assess the possibilities of this approach are presented.

Рассматриваются два алгоритма: простая сшивка, когда участок дна, видимый на каждом изображении, аппроксимируется плоскостью, и сшивка на основе трехмерной модели дна. Purpose. Seabed mosaics are built of tens of thousands of images obtained by the AUV at a small distance from the bottom. The height of the survey is limited by the power of the AUV lighting equipment and the transparency of the water and is often comparable with the differences in the heights of the bottom. This leads to strong distortions caused by parallax, which makes standard stitching methods inapplicable to the construction of photographic maps of the bottom with a complex relief. Methodology. The article proposes to consider the problem of constructing seabed mosaics as a problem of 3D reconstruction. Two approaches to stitching images are described: simple stitching and based on a 3D bottom model. With simple stitching, the relief represented by each image is approximated by a plane that is then projected onto the common plane of the seabed mosaic. When stitching based on a 3D model, the bottom section model is first constructed using the Delaunay triangulation, and then each triangle of the model is projected onto the plane of the map using a graphic accelerator GPU. To mix colors, a simple method of weighting the pixels of images is used, depending on their distance from the edges of the image. Findings. Stitching algorithms proposed in the paper were tested on images obtained by both real AUV and synthetic images. This allowed us to verify efficiency of stitching algorithms for conditions of a highly complex relief. In combination with simple color blending techniques, proposed algorithms have shown their practical efficiency. The stitching algorithm, based on the 3D model demonstrated its robustness to distortions caused by parallax. Originality/value. The main advantage of described approach is an absence of necessity to use computationally consuming, nontrivial color blending techniques while constructing seabed mosaics in the case of complex bottom relief.

Three-dimensional Dirichlet problems for the Helmholtz equation are considered in generalized formulations. By applying single-layer potentials, they are reduced to Fredholm boundary integral equations of the first kind. The equations are discretized using a special averaging method for integral operators with weak singularities in the kernels. As a result, the integral equations are approximated by systems of linear algebraic equations with easy-to-compute coefficients, which are solved numerically by applying the generalized minimal residual method. A modification of the method is proposed that yields solutions in the spectra of interior Dirichlet problems and integral operators when the integral equations are not equivalent to the original differential problems and are not well-posed. Numerical results are presented for assessing the capabilities of the approach.
